Assistant General Manager (QSR Outlets) at Goldplates Feast House

Posted on Tue 07th Jul, 2026 - hotnigerianjobs.com --- (0 comments)


Goldplates Feast House - We are a dynamic and rapidly growing Quick Service Restaurant (QSR) brand committed to excellence in food quality, customer satisfaction, and operational standards.

We are recruiting to fill the position below:

Job Title: Assistant General Manager (QSR Outlets)

Location: Chevron drive,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time

Job Description

  • The Assistant General Manager (AGM) / Head of Operations serves as a senior leadership figure responsible for the seamless day-to-day running of the restaurant, bridging culinary excellence with strong operational and administrative governance.
  • This role demands a leader who is as comfortable reviewing food cost reports as they are refining a signature recipe.
  • The AGM will deputise for the General Manager, drive performance across all departments, and ensure that the establishment delivers a consistently outstanding guest experience while meeting financial and operational targets.

Key Responsibilities
Operational Leadership:

  • Oversee all daily restaurant operations across front-of-house, back-of-house, and administrative functions.
  • Deputise for the General Manager in their absence, assuming full operational authority.
  • Establish, implement, and enforce standard operating procedures (SOPs) across all departments.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ance service quality, efficiency, and profitability.
  • Lead cross-functional team meetings and ensure alignment between kitchen, service, and admin teams.

Culinary Oversight & Recipe Management:

  • Collaborate with the Head Chef/QC to develop, test, cost, and document standardised recipes and menus.
  • Ensure culinary output consistently meets brand quality standards in taste, presentation, and portioning.
  • Monitor and enforce food safety, hygiene, and HACCP compliance across all food handling areas.
  • Drive menu innovation in line with market trends, seasonal availability, and guest feedback.
  • Oversee recipe costing and ensure menu pricing supports target food cost margins.

Financial & Administrative Management:

  • Manage operational budgets including food cost, labour cost, and overheads — reporting variances to the GM.
  • Ensure procurement, supplier negotiations, and inventory control to minimise waste and optimise spend.
  • Prepare weekly and monthly performance reports covering revenue, costs, covers, and guest satisfaction metrics.
  • Coordinate with operations team on staff scheduling and ensure labour efficiency across all shifts.
  • Coordinate with finance and HR on administrative processes, compliance, and reporting requirements.

Guest Experience & Brand Standards:

  • Act as a brand ambassador, upholding the restaurant's identity, values, and service philosophy.
  • Monitor guest feedback (in-person, online reviews) and implement corrective actions swiftly.
  • Manage escalated guest complaints with professionalism and a solutions-first mindset.

Qualifications & Requirements
Education & Experience: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Hospitality Management, Culinary Arts, Business Administration, or a related field (preferred).
  • 4–5 years of experience in food service operations, with at least 3 years in a senior management role.
  • Demonstrable background in recipe development, menu engineering, and culinary administration.
  • Proven experience managing P&L, budgets, and multi-departmental teams in a restaurant environment.

Skills & Competencies:

  • Strong culinary knowledge with the ability to evaluate food quality, recipe accuracy, and kitchen performance.
  • Excellent financial acumen — comfortable with cost analysis, budgeting, and performance reporting.
  • Proficiency in restaurant management systems (POS, inventory, scheduling software) and MS Office Suite.
  • Outstanding leadership presence with the ability to inspire, hold accountability, and develop people.
  • Highly organised with the ability to prioritise and manage multiple operational workstreams simultaneously.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ills across all levels of the organisation.
  • Deep knowledge of food safety regulations, HACCP principles, and health & safety compliance.
